So, what's the deal with the dialysate compartment? Picture this: inside a dialyzer, blood flows through hollow fibers, and surrounding those fibers is where the magic really happens—the dialysate compartment. This setup lets the dialysate solution perform its role in the hemodialysis process. The blood circulates through those fibers, and as it flows, waste products and excess fluids pass through the fibers into the dialysate. It’s like a perfectly timed dance between the blood and the dialysate, ensuring toxins are pulled away efficiently.

Now, let’s break it down further. In hemodialysis, waste removal is a two-part process, involving both diffusion and ultrafiltration. Diffusion occurs due to concentration gradients: when the level of certain substances is higher in the blood compared to the dialysate, those substances move into the dialysate. And just like how we define boundaries in our lives, the fibers do that with the blood and dialysate. The blood compartment refers to where your patient’s blood is transported through those fibers—not to be confused with the dialysate compartment.
